JJessica Pierschbacheressica touched many youth and adults with her kindness, caring, and fairness in 4H and by being a great person during her 16 years of life.
She helped many youth to see the value and good of being involved in 4H.
She was a true example of what 4H is about and why learning by doing develops skill and character.

Jessica’s ability to provide leadership, share a caring attitude, and assist others to learn and do was practiced continuously in 4H.  She cared deeply about people around her, doing the right thing at the right time, sharing a great smile, and being a positive role model.  She impacted her local club and 4H members in Ringgold County with her can-do spirit even when she was extremely ill.  Jessica was an excellent example of practicing citizenship in all that she did in her club and on the county level. Jessica’s last 4H activity was leading a fleece blanket workshop in her club so hospitalized children would take a blanket with them when they were well enough to go home. Jessica touched many people with her kindness, caring, fairness, and by being a great person.
